    The Grand Palace from across the Chao Phraya River, c. 1880. The Grand Palace is divided into four main courts, separated by numerous walls and gates: the Outer Court, the Middle Court, the Inner Court and the Temple of the Emerald Buddha. Each of these court's functions and access are clearly defined by laws and traditions.

    Upon his return he appropriated land for the construction of a royal garden which he named "Dusit Garden". [1] [2] [3] Vimanmek Palace was constructed in 1900 by having the Munthatu Rattanaroj Residence in Phra Chuthathut Palace at Ko Sichang, Chonburi, dismantled and reassembled in Dusit Garden. It was the first permanent residence in the garden.

    The temple's name literally means 'the Temple of the fifth King located near Dusit Palace'. [2] It was designed by Prince Naris , a half-brother of the king, and is built of Italian marble . [ 1 ] It has display of Carrara marble pillars, a marble courtyard and two large singhas (lions) guarding the entrance to the bot.
